James Suckling
- js94
Fermented in 3,000-liter Hungarian oak tanks, this complex and layered wine is made from white Rhone varieties. It's 40% roussanne, 21% vermentino, 20% grenache blanc, 10% marsanne, 6% picpoul blanc and 3% clairette blanche. While ripe and generous, it's also tangy and slightly tannic, with a fresh bite in texture. Medium-bodied. Drink or hold.
Jeb Dunnuck
- jd93
The 2022 Theresa is based largely on Roussanne (40%) yet has smaller amounts of Vermentino, Grenache Blanc, Marsanne, and other varieties. It has a slightly hazy gold hue as well as a singular nose of dried herbs, minty citrus, melon, and toasted nuts. Slightly reductive at first, it opens up beautifully with air, and it's medium-bodied, has a focused, elegant mouthfeel, good concentration, and a distinct salinity on the finish. It's going to absolutely shine on the dinner table.
Vinous
- v90
The 2022 Theresa is fresh, with a floral air giving way to hints of lime and wet stones. This is soft-textured with ripe orchard fruits and tactile mineral tones up front. It finishes with grip and notes of sour citrus, leaving an herbal tinge to linger on.
